What are biblical principles?
Biblical principles are guidelines and teachings found in the Bible Sacred, which guide the conduct and morals of the faithful. They are considered essential to the Christian life and to understanding God's will.
The Importance of Biblical Principles
Biblical principles are essential for Christians, as they provide moral, ethical, and spiritual guidance for decision-making and daily conduct. They help believers live in accordance with God’s will and remain steadfast in faith.
Examples of biblical principles
Some examples of biblical principles include loving your neighbor as yourself, forgiving offenses, practicing justice and mercy, and honoring your father and mother, among others. These teachings are found in specific passages of the Bible and are considered fundamental to Christian conduct.
